Branding Strategies in the Attention Economy: Navigating the VUCA and BANI World
Author(s) | Mrs. Nidhi Menaria |
---|---|
Country | India |
Abstract | The dynamics of the international marketplace have moved radically with the start of the attention economy, where capturing and sustaining audience attention has become an important strength. This paper explores the juncture of branding strategies and the emerging paradigms of VUCA (Volatile, Uncertain, Complex, Ambiguous) and BANI (Brittle, Anxious, Nonlinear, Incomprehensible). Drawing on modern research and industry insights, the paper outlines how brands can remain resistant, reliable, and applicable amidst constant change and attention scarcity. |
